For many years, I have been having students fill out a half sheet as they
complete a Caudill.  They list the book title, author, and write up to 4
sentences of why they liked, or disliked the book, including a brief
summary or possibly just a summary of their favorite part.   The paper must
be signed by a parent or a teacher, as I really can't see if they READ the
book, only that it is checked out.  We keep track of these in the library
and when students vote, they get a personal ballot with the books they read
highlighted.  It seems to work fairly well... I may ask the occasional
question if I have any questions about what they have written...

I also started a "Caudill Club"  in which students must read a certain
number of Caudills to be able to attend the meeting. Our first meeting will
be in October.  They have to have read 1 Caudill.  Our first meeting
meeting is called Caudill and Cookies, and I will provide cookies.  In
November, they have to read 2 Caudills to attend.  That meeting is Caudill
and Cupcakes... and so on... And they have to have turned in the signed
sheets to be able to participate.  Nothing fancy, but these things have
worked nicely for me.
